Richard Evan ROWLANDS

Regimental number437
Place of birthBallarat Victoria
ReligionChurch of England
OccupationMotor mechanic
Address40 Anderson Street, West Ballarat, Victoria
Marital statusSingle
Age at embarkation20
Next of kinFather, Edward Rowlands, 40 Anderson Street, West Ballarat, Victoria
Enlistment date10 February 1915
Date of enlistment from Nominal Roll23 January 1915
Rank on enlistmentPrivate
Unit name23rd Battalion, B Company
AWM Embarkation Roll number23/40/1
Embarkation detailsUnit embarked from Melbourne, Victoria, on board HMAT A14 Euripides on 10 May 1915
Rank from Nominal RollPrivate
Unit from Nominal Roll23rd Battalion
FateReturned to Australia 18 December 1918
Family/military connectionsBrother: 15577 Pte Lewis ROWLANDS, 6th Field Ambulance, killed in action, 21-22 April 1917.
Other details

War service: Egypt, Gallipoli, Western Front

Medals: 1914-15 Star, British War Medal, Victory Medal
